Assistant Chief Flight Instructor information

What are the primary responsibilities of an Assistant Chief Flight Instructor on a typical day?

An Assistant Chief Flight Instructor typically oversees and supports flight instructors, conducts student progress evaluations, and ensures adherence to training standards and safety protocols. Responsibilities may also include scheduling training flights, providing advanced instruction, running ground school sessions, and helping maintain training records. You'll work closely with the chief flight instructor, students, and staff to ensure efficient training operations. Collaboration and hands-on involvement are common, allowing you to make a direct impact on the quality and safety of the instruction provided.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Assistant Chief Flight Instructor position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Chief Flight Instructor, you need extensive flight experience, strong instructional abilities, and relevant credentials such as FAA Certified Flight Instructor (CFI) and often CFII or MEI ratings. Familiarity with flight training management software, aircraft scheduling systems, and proficiency with flight simulators are typically required. Excellent leadership, mentorship, communication, and problem-solving skills set standout candidates apart in this role. These skills and qualifications ensure the safe and effective training of student pilots, smooth operation of the flight school, and strong support of the chief flight instructor.

What does an Assistant Chief Flight Instructor do?

An Assistant Chief Flight Instructor (ACFI) supports the Chief Flight Instructor in managing flight training operations at a flight school. They help oversee instructor performance, ensure compliance with aviation regulations, and assist in curriculum development. Additionally, they may conduct flight and ground training, evaluate student progress, and ensure safety standards are met. Their role is crucial in maintaining high-quality training and fostering a safe learning environment for aspiring pilots.
